Celebrity Surprise: Former New Zealand Prime Minister Jacinda Ardern Delights Staff at Berry Newsagency

Celebrity Surprise: Former New Zealand Prime Minister Jacinda Ardern Delights Staff at Berry Newsagency

In a heartwarming display of humility and kindness, former New Zealand Prime Minister Jacinda Ardern surprised the staff at Berry Newsagency with a visit, leaving a lasting impression on the small town. The newsagency, owned by Tammy O'Keefe, has become a hub for celebrities and public figures, with the likes of Garry McDonald, Ray Martin, Andrew Johns, and Shane Flanagan having walked through its doors in the past.

On Monday, July 13, Ms O'Keefe was thrilled to see Ms Ardern browsing through the store, exclaiming, 'Oh my goodness, you have my book.' The book in question was Ms Ardern's new title, 'What If You Could?', which has been making waves in literary circles. Ms O'Keefe, who admitted to getting starstruck when celebrities visit her store, had the opportunity to chat with Ms Ardern and found her to be 'lovely' and 'incredibly warm, genuine, and generous with her time'.

During their conversation, Ms Ardern revealed that she was living in Sydney but had traveled to Kiama to visit friends and had made her first trip to Berry. She was smitten with the town's beauty and charm, saying it was 'absolutely beautiful' and that she 'loved it.'
